Looking for the best cars in India 2025? Here’s a detailed guide to the top 10 cars with price, mileage, and features that are trending this year.
Car market in India right now? It’s crazy. Everyone wants something different – fuel efficiency, cool features, space for family, or even just a car that looks good outside the café. In 2025, choices are wider than ever. Hatchbacks, SUVs, electric cars, hybrids… buyers really got too many options.
So instead of getting lost in brochures and fancy ads, let’s just keep it simple. Here’s a breakdown of the top 10 cars in India 2025—with their price, mileage and what makes them worth the money.
1. Maruti Suzuki Swift 2025
Price: ₹6.5 – ₹9.8 lakh
Mileage: 22–25 km/l
Features: Touchscreen, six airbags, hybrid tech, decent boot space.
The Swift never dies. It’s still that “all-rounder” car everyone in India loves. Cheap to run, easy to park, and now hybrid version gives you more mileage. Not super premium, but honestly? It just works.
2. Hyundai Creta 2025
Price: ₹11 – ₹19 lakh
Mileage: 17–21 km/l
Features: Sunroof, ADAS, ventilated seats, digital cluster.
Creta is like the king of compact SUVs. Everywhere you look, there’s one on the road. Hyundai just keeps adding features to make it more premium but price is still not too crazy. Families go for it, young buyers too.
3. Tata Punch EV 2025
Price: ₹10 – ₹14 lakh
Range: 300–400 km per charge
Features: Fast charging, connected tech, multiple drive modes.
This one’s interesting. Punch EV is small but tough. Perfect for city runs. You charge it, drive it, no fuel headache. Plus Tata keeps pricing its EVs smart, so it feels accessible.
4. Mahindra XUV700 2025
Price: ₹14 – ₹26 lakh
Mileage: 15–18 km/l
Features: Dual screens, ADAS, panoramic sunroof.
If you want that “big SUV vibe” without going full luxury brands, this is it. Mahindra nailed it with XUV700. Still in demand in 2025, still a long waiting list.
5. Kia Seltos 2025
Price: ₹11 – ₹18 lakh
Mileage: 17–21 km/l
Features: Stylish design, Bose sound, ventilated seats.
Seltos feels like a younger cousin of Creta but with more style. Kia is focusing on interiors and tech, so this one attracts mostly urban buyers who want “premium but not too expensive.”
6. Tata Nexon EV 2025
Price: ₹14 – ₹20 lakh
Range: 400–500 km per charge
Features: New design, big infotainment screen, ADAS, quick charging.
This is India’s favorite EV, no doubt. Tata keeps improving it every year. By 2025, the Nexon EV can easily do long drives too, not just city commutes. Solid option if you want to go green.
7. The 2025 Toyota Innova Hycross
Cost: ₹18–30 lakh
Driving distance: 20–23 km/l (Hybrid)
Features: Large cabin, captain’s seats, hybrid engine.
Innova is a brand itself in India. Families, travel agencies, long-distance drivers… everyone trusts it. The Hycross with hybrid setup gives good mileage despite size. Expensive, yes, but reliable.
8. Maruti Suzuki Baleno 2025
Price: ₹7 – ₹11 lakh
Mileage: 22–25 km/l
Features: 360-camera, touchscreen, six airbags.
Baleno is for those who want something above Swift but still affordable. Feels premium, looks stylish, and with hybrid option it sips less fuel. A safe pick if you’re in the 8–10 lakh range.
9. Hyundai Verna 2025
Price: ₹11 – ₹17 lakh
Mileage: 18–22 km/l
Features: ADAS, turbo engine, ventilated seats.
Sedan lovers still exist, and Verna is their best bet. The new design is bold, almost futuristic. It’s not cheap but offers features that make even some SUVs jealous.
10. MG Hector 2025
Price: ₹15 – ₹22 lakh
Mileage: 15–18 km/l
Features: Huge touchscreen, panoramic sunroof, AI voice assist.
MG Hector is more like a “gadget on wheels.” If you like tech, you’ll love it. Big SUV, loaded features, and not crazy priced compared to size.
Car Trends in 2025 India
- SUVs are still ruling, no question.
- EVs are picking up fast, especially Tata and MG.
- Hybrids are safe bets for buyers who don’t fully trust charging infra yet.
- ADAS and 6 airbags are now almost standard, showing that safety is becoming more important.
Quick Buying Tips
- Hatchback if you drive mostly in city.
- SUV if family + long drives.
- EV if you got charging setup at home or office.
- Always check safety rating, don’t just go for “kitna deti hai.”
- Budget wisely, EMI + fuel/charging + maintenance all add up.
Final Thoughts
2025 looks exciting for Indian car buyers. Whether you want a small hatch like Swift, a feature-rich SUV like Creta or Seltos, a reliable family car like Innova, or you’re jumping into the future with EVs like Nexon and Punch—there’s something for everyone.
Cars are no longer only about mileage; they are about lifestyle. In India, lifestyle preferences are changing toward technology, safety, and sustainable mobility.